Message type: E = Error
Message class: CRM_MKTLIST_PACKAGE - CRM Marketing: Messages External List Management
Message number: 071
Message text: Cannot use delimiter type &1

- Cannot use delimiter type &1 ?The SAP error message
CRM_MKTLIST_PACKAGE071
with the description "Cannot use delimiter type &1" typically occurs in the context of marketing lists in SAP CRM (Customer Relationship Management). This error indicates that there is an issue with the delimiter type being used in a marketing list or related data processing.Cause:
The error can be caused by several factors, including:
- Invalid Delimiter Type: The delimiter type specified in the marketing list configuration is not recognized or is not valid for the operation being performed.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ration settings in the CRM system related to marketing lists or the specific delimiter types allowed.
- Data Integrity Issues: The data being processed may contain unexpected or malformed entries that do not conform to the expected delimiter types.
Solution:
To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:
Check Delimiter Configuration:
- Go to the configuration settings for marketing lists in SAP CRM.
- Verify the delimiter types that are defined and ensure that the one you are trying to use is valid and correctly configured.
Review Marketing List Settings:
- Check the specific marketing list that is causing the error. Ensure that all settings, including delimiters, are correctly defined.
- If you are using a custom delimiter, ensure that it is supported by the system.
Data Validation:
- Review the data being processed in the marketing list. Look for any entries that may contain invalid or unexpected delimiter types.
- Clean up any data that does not conform to the expected format.
Consult Documentation:
-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idelines on configuring marketing lists and delimiters.
SAP Notes and Support:
-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error.
- If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ance.
